Output 86ec380a5d1e55a918d6c962abbcd559990b3a85edbd65d8c82d0a2e2b397ce3:25

value
132408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a97b9341411425d9c7a4bcd8f3338862674aff OP_EQUAL
address
3QMpXyyqHGi9RknJgfLVVtpPe5U7LDSEWM
transaction
86ec380a5d1e55a918d6c962abbcd559990b3a85edbd65d8c82d0a2e2b397ce3